Queen Street Mall is Brisbane's main shopping and dining destination, a pedestrian-only street stretching through the city center. It houses more than 700 stores, including major department stores like Myer and David Jones, boutique shops, and international brands. The mall also offers a wide range of restaurants, cafes, and street food options, along with entertainment venues such as the Wintergarden cinema. With its bustling energy and frequent street performances, it's a hub for both shoppers and sightseers. The mall connects to other key areas like the Queen Street Bus Station and the Brisbane Arcade.
